This year it will be 20 years since Romania freed itself from communism. This may seem like a long time, but practically it was not, when I think how much still has to be done. A lot.
Sometimes it seems that nothing has changed, that the communist ideals still rule. Like here, on this photo, taken when I visited with some other foreigners the forests around Suceava to see how people harvest and work there. It was like before 1989, when the communist leaders came in a visit.
Imagine: a convoi of cars entering the forest on a newly paved forest road, the workers standing straight and saluting like at the army, a brandnew, never before used tractor and six decorated horses pulling logs out of the forest, everything has fresh paint on it, the chairs, the tables. The entire forest cleaned of anything that could disturb the eye, some nice people offering boiled schnaps against the cold, and some delicious cakes, even the soil covered with brushwood that our shoes would not get dirty. And on top of it all deer that would not run away, but actually came towards us so that we could pet them. So much work, so much care invested into the preparation of this visit, and it all came out wrong.
Disneyland forest.
